International Students' Proactive Behaviors in the United States: Effects of Information-Seeking Behaviors on School Life
Cho, Jaehee; Lee, Seungjo
Journal of College Student Development, v57 n5 p590-603 Jul 2016
Considering the continuous increase of international students, the main goal of this study was to examine how international students' proactive behaviors, particularly information seeking behaviors, would impact key emotional outcomes including communication satisfaction with instructors and school-life satisfaction. For this investigation, we developed and tested a systematic model composed of those key factors. Results from structural equation modeling (SEM) supported most of the proposed hypotheses, It was particularly notable that the inquiry of information as a proactive form of communication was positively related to international students' communication satisfaction with instructors, which ultimately predicts school satisfaction.
